Ravens Receive Huge Lamar Jackson News for the Week 8 Bears Clash
Summary
Lamar Jackson, the quarterback for the Baltimore Ravens, is set to play in Week 8 against the Chicago Bears after recovering from a hamstring injury. Jackson was injured in Week 4, and the team has struggled without him, losing four consecutive games. His return is important as the Ravens aim to improve their season.Key Facts
- Lamar Jackson is the quarterback for the Baltimore Ravens.
- Jackson suffered a hamstring injury in Week 4 and missed two games.
- He was limited in practice but became a full participant by Friday.
- The Ravens have lost four straight games since his injury.
- The team is playing against the Chicago Bears in Week 8.
- The Ravens' current season record is 1-5.
- A sports analyst, Albert Breer, has predicted a positive playoff outlook for the Ravens despite their current losing streak.
- Baltimore's upcoming schedule is considered easier, increasing their chances for future wins.
